Tips for Lighting Laundry Rooms, Home Offices & Workrooms

Posted on February 24, 2012 By jlamberski (Edit) Leave a Comment

Of course, proper lighting is necessary to be able to effectively use laundry rooms, home offices and other workrooms. But lighting schemes can provide more than function. The right lighting can create a cozy, comfortable environment that will enhance moods and make work and chores more enjoyable.  From the American Lighting Association and Better Homes & Garden’s Lighting magazine, here are the different layers of light that you can incorporate to achieve a functional and pleasant lighting scheme in your laundry room, home office or workroom.

  • Task lighting provides practical illumination for laundry, reading and other work that requires plenty of lighting and usually comes in the form of a portable lamp or pendant fixtures.
  • Overhead lighting from a ceiling fan fixture, pendants or recessed fixtures is crucial for functionality at night.
  • Ambient lighting in the form of undercabinet lighting or adjustable track lighting on book shelves or artwork can supplement task and overhead lighting for a more agreeable atmosphere.
